Honestly? shen is pretty much straightfoward but you need lots of practice. He is easy to learn but has a high skill ceiling. But basic things,

  • Mind your energy! spam spam spam and you'll have nothing left to use your moves with.
  • make the most of your shield in lane in trades, so when your shield is up make the trades! not before it is your sustain.
  • Ult a little early regardless of how the ult shield scales. If they day your ult is a no go, and it has a considerable amount of CD time you don't want to waste it
  • even though he is a tank his specialty is honestly juking. He can juke sooo incredibly well you can cause a chase to save someone or just distract them for incredibly long and survive

If you E onto someone, also hit Q to instantly get three empowered auto attacks and cut off maybe a seconds different between your first set of empowered auto attacks and your second set of empowered auto attacks

Shen's W can block any autoattack, so try to block an empowered autoattack if possible.

About the ult, only use it when there is a play to be made. It's a super long cool down and you can only use it at the right time. On top of that everytime you do use it, you are putting your opponent laner ahead. It's important to catch up in farm.

Know what your W can block. It can block any auto(duh) but also enhanced autos(nasus q and even Garen q) and three hit passive procs like gnars magic damage and vaynes true damage. It's also possible to block Warwicks ult (lol) see him dive you with R? Click W.

Also get Tiamat for waveclear into Titanic Hydra, honestly Sunfire cape is trash, I still wonder why I build it when Hydra is a superior waveclear item and actually adds to your damage output towards champions.
